Homoeopathy has a stronger patient base in India than most people outside the healthcare system realise. The National Family Health Survey and NSSO data consistently show 10-15% of Indians use homoeopathy as a primary or complementary system. Karnataka's AYUSH department operates hundreds of government homoeopathic dispensaries. Private homoeopathic practice in chronic disease management — particularly for eczema, psoriasis, allergies, autoimmune conditions and paediatric recurrent infections — has a loyal patient base that doesn't disappear when pharma marketing trends change. This is the employment context that Bapuji Homoeopathic Medical College graduates in Davangere enter.
Bapuji Homoeopathic Medical College was established in 1980 under the Bapuji Educational Association — the same trust that runs Bapuji Dental College (one of Karnataka's most established dental colleges), Bapuji Institute of Engineering and Technology (BIET, 2500+ students) and Bapuji Medical College in Davangere. NAAC A accreditation at a homoeopathy college is unusual — most BHMS colleges in Karnataka hold lower grades or none at all. The Bapuji group's multi-disciplinary Davangere campus means BHMS students operate adjacent to dental, engineering and allopathic medical students — a cross-disciplinary environment with practical value for interdisciplinary understanding of disease.
BHMS admission uses the same NEET UG examination as MBBS but through KEA Karnataka's AYUSH counselling — a separate process with a separate counselling schedule. BHMS NEET cutoffs for Karnataka private colleges are typically 250-380 for general category. Government homoeopathy colleges require higher scores. The 150-seat intake at Bapuji means reasonable batch sizes. CCH (Central Council of Homoeopathy) approval is the mandatory regulatory requirement for all BHMS programmes in India — Bapuji has this along with RGUHS affiliation.
The BHMS curriculum runs 4.5 years followed by 1 year compulsory rotating internship. The first two years are Organon of Medicine (Hahnemann's philosophical foundation), Materia Medica, Homoeopathic Pharmacy, Anatomy and Physiology. From third year, clinical subjects include Medicine, Surgery, Obstetrics and Gynaecology, Paediatrics and Homoeopathic Case Taking and Repertorisation. Repertorisation — the systematic matching of patient symptoms to Homoeopathic remedies using reference works like Kent's Repertory and Synthesis — is a core skill that separates trained BHMS practitioners from self-taught Homoeopathic prescribers. The Bapuji clinical training attaches students to the Bapuji group hospitals in Davangere for their clinical exposure.
Davangere as a location has specific relevance for Homoeopathic practice. The city is Karnataka's third-largest commercial centre, on NH-48 (Bangalore-Pune highway), 260 km from Bangalore. Davangere's cotton and agricultural commodity market, combined with a large lower-middle class population, creates strong demand for affordable Homoeopathic care in primary health settings. Private Homoeopathic practice in Tier-2 cities like Davangere, Tumkur and Hubli is commercially more viable than in Bangalore, where competition from allopathic specialists is intense. BHMS graduates from Bapuji who return to their home districts in Central Karnataka often build thriving practices within 3-5 years.
MD Homoeopathy is the postgraduate route — via AIAPGET (All India Ayush PG Entrance Test) by NTA. MD Homoeopathy specialisations include Organon of Medicine, Materia Medica, Practice of Medicine, Paediatrics and Repertory. Government service as Medical Officer (Homoeopathy) in Karnataka Health Department's AYUSH division is the stable employment pathway. Karnataka has been steadily expanding AYUSH government dispensary infrastructure. Central government CGHS (Central Government Health Scheme) also employs homoeopathic practitioners at Bangalore's CGHS wellness centres.

Frequently Asked Questions
Is BHMS the same as BAMS?
No. BHMS (Bachelor of Homoeopathic Medicine and Surgery) is Homoeopathy, regulated by CCH under the AYUSH Ministry. BAMS (Bachelor of Ayurvedic Medicine and Surgery) is Ayurveda, regulated by CCIM. Both are 5.5-year AYUSH medical degrees requiring NEET UG, but involve entirely different medical systems, treatments and regulatory boards.
What is the NEET cutoff for BHMS at Bapuji Homoeopathic Medical College?
Private BHMS colleges in Karnataka typically require 250-380 NEET marks for general category. Verify Bapuji's specific current year cutoffs at kea.kar.nic.in under AYUSH counselling.
What career options exist after BHMS?
Private Homoeopathic practice (Karnataka Homoeopathic Practitioners Board registration), Karnataka AYUSH government dispensaries (Medical Officer Homoeopathy posts), CGHS Homoeopathic wellness centres, MD Homoeopathy via AIAPGET, and integrative medicine clinics employing BHMS practitioners alongside allopathic doctors.
What is the duration of BHMS?
4.5 years of academic study plus 1 year compulsory rotating internship — total 5.5 years. Same duration as MBBS and BAMS.
What is the Bapuji group's reputation in Davangere?
The Bapuji Educational Association is one of Davangere's most established educational institutions — operating dental, engineering, allopathic medical and homoeopathic medical colleges since the 1960s-1980s. The multi-disciplinary group has deep alumni penetration in Davangere's healthcare and professional sectors.
Can BHMS graduates prescribe allopathic medicines?
No. BHMS graduates are licensed to practise Homoeopathic medicine only. In Karnataka, BHMS practitioners registered with the Homoeopathic Practitioners Board practise within the Homoeopathic system. Prescribing allopathic drugs requires separate MBBS qualification.
What is MD Homoeopathy and how do I pursue it after BHMS?
MD Homoeopathy is the 3-year postgraduate programme in Homoeopathic specialisations. Qualify AIAPGET (All India Ayush PG Entrance Test) by NTA. Specialisations include Organon of Medicine, Materia Medica, Practice of Medicine and Paediatrics. State-level AYUSH PG counselling is also conducted by some states.
Is the Bapuji BHMS degree from RGUHS valid nationally?
Yes. BHMS from a CCH-approved, RGUHS-affiliated college is valid nationally. Graduates can register with the homoeopathic practitioner board of any Indian state. For international practice, country-specific requirements apply.
What is the fee for BHMS at Bapuji Homoeopathic Medical College?
Fees are regulated through KEA Karnataka AYUSH counselling. Private BHMS fees in Karnataka typically range from Rs 60,000 to Rs 2 lakh per year. Verify current fees at kea.kar.nic.in.
Does Bapuji Homoeopathic Medical College have hostel facilities?
The Bapuji group campus in Davangere has hostel facilities for students across its colleges. Verify current availability and fees through the college admissions office or KEA AYUSH counselling documentation.
The Bapuji group's most practically useful asset for BHMS graduates isn't its engineering or dental college proximity — it's Bapuji Medical College's established allopathic clinical network in Davangere. Homoeopathic practitioners who build referral relationships with allopathic general practitioners get cases they'd never attract independently. Chronic skin conditions, recurrent childhood infections, irritable bowel syndrome, anxiety disorders and certain autoimmune conditions are areas where allopathic practitioners frequently refer patients who haven't responded to standard protocols. A BHMS graduate in Davangere with faculty connections at Bapuji Medical College through the shared educational ecosystem is better positioned to build these cross-referral relationships than a graduate from a standalone homoeopathy college with no allopathic network.
Karnataka Homoeopathic Practitioners Board (KHPB) registration is required before commencing practice. Registration requires the BHMS degree certificate, mark sheets, internship completion certificate and registration fee payment — typically 3-6 weeks processing time. Government AYUSH Medical Officer vacancies for Homoeopathy in Karnataka are advertised through KPSC (Karnataka Public Service Commission). Monitor KPSC notifications alongside BHMS completion for timely application to government service positions. Karnataka has been steadily expanding AYUSH government dispensary infrastructure — Medical Officer (Homoeopathy) posts have been regularly advertised in recent years across the state's AYUSH department.
The BHMS curriculum emphasises materia medica — the systematic study of homoeopathic remedies and their symptom profiles — in a way that has no direct parallel in MBBS or BAMS. Successful BHMS graduates develop an instinct for remedy matching through years of case study and supervised practice. This skill is not taught by textbooks alone; it's built through clinical case exposure under experienced Homoeopathic supervisors. The quality of supervision during BHMS clinical training varies significantly between institutions. Bapuji's NAAC A grade relative to most Karnataka BHMS colleges suggests above-average clinical supervision quality, but a campus visit and conversation with current students will give you more reliable information than any accreditation score.
